XRank and Beyond: How to Use Advanced Analytics to Take Your Fantasy Hockey Game to the Next Level

If you’re serious about winning your Yahoo Fantasy Hockey league, you need to go beyond basic XRank analysis. Advanced analytics can help you identify undervalued players, avoid traps, and gain a strategic edge over your opponents. Here are some tips for using advanced analytics to take your fantasy hockey game to the next level:

First, focus on more than just goals and assists. Advanced analytics can help you evaluate players’ contributions to their team’s possession and defensive play, which can be just as important as offensive production. Look for players with strong Corsi, Fenwick, and defensive point shares.

Utilize the Power of Zone Starts

  • Zone starts are an often-overlooked statistic that can reveal a player’s role on his team. If a player consistently starts shifts in the offensive zone, he’s more likely to produce points, while players who start in the defensive zone are more likely to focus on defensive responsibilities.
  • Use zone starts to identify players who are being deployed in favorable situations and those who are being used in more challenging roles.

Track Advanced Goaltending Metrics

  • Goaltending can make or break your fantasy hockey team, so it’s important to evaluate goalies beyond just wins and losses. Advanced metrics like goals saved above average (GSAA), high-danger save percentage, and low-danger save percentage can help you identify goalies who are performing well despite facing a lot of shots.
  • Look for goalies with a high save percentage on high-danger shots, as these are the shots that are most likely to result in goals.

Consider Contextual Factors

  • Advanced analytics can also help you evaluate players’ performances in the context of their team and the league as a whole. For example, a player who scores a lot of power play points may not be as valuable if his team doesn’t get many power play opportunities.
  • Consider factors like a team’s style of play, injuries, and strength of schedule when making roster decisions.

By utilizing these advanced analytics, you can gain a deeper understanding of players’ performances and make more informed roster decisions. Remember to go beyond just XRank analysis and consider factors like zone starts, advanced goaltending metrics, and contextual factors to take your fantasy hockey game to the next level.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Does Xrank Mean In Yahoo Fantasy Hockey?

Xrank is Yahoo’s ranking system that provides a measure of a player’s overall fantasy value. The system takes into account a player’s recent performance, injury history, and other factors to determine their ranking.

How Is Xrank Calculated?

The exact formula used to calculate Xrank is proprietary and not disclosed by Yahoo. However, it is known to take into account a player’s recent performance, injury history, playing time, and other factors.

Why Is Xrank Important?

Xrank is important because it can help you make informed decisions about which players to draft, trade for, or add/drop from your team. By looking at a player’s Xrank, you can get a sense of their overall value and compare them to other players in the league.

Is Xrank the Only Factor I Should Consider When Drafting Players?

No, Xrank should not be the only factor you consider when drafting players. It’s important to also consider a player’s position, playing time, team, injury history, and other factors that may affect their performance.

Can Xrank Help Me Win My Fantasy Hockey League?

While Xrank can provide valuable information about a player’s fantasy value, it is just one tool in your arsenal. Winning your fantasy hockey league requires a combination of good drafting, savvy trading, and strategic lineup decisions throughout the season.

Where Can I Find Xrank In Yahoo Fantasy Hockey?

Xrank can be found in the player rankings section of Yahoo Fantasy Hockey. You can also view a player’s Xrank on their individual player card, which provides additional information about their recent performance and upcoming schedule.
